// vite.config.js
import { resolve } from 'path';
import { defineConfig } from 'vite';
import { glob } from 'glob';
const sourceDir = resolve(__dirname, 'src');
// Find all HTML files in the 'public' and 'protected' directories
const allHtmlFiles = glob.sync('**/*.html', {
cwd: sourceDir, // Search from the source directory
ignore: ['node_modules/**'],
});
// Create a mapping of file names to their full paths for Vite
const inputFiles = {};
allHtmlFiles.forEach(file => {
// Replace the slashes with hyphens to create a flat output name.
// Example: 'protected/functionCall.html' becomes 'protected-functionCall'
const name = file.replace(/\.html$/, '').replace(/[/\\]/g, '-');
inputFiles[name] = resolve(sourceDir, file);
});
export default defineConfig({
// The root for the dev server is now the 'src' directory.
root: 'src',
// This is the config for the build process
build: {
// The output directory for the production build
outDir: resolve(__dirname, 'build'),
// It's a good practice to clear the build directory on each new build
emptyOutDir: true,
// Specify custom rollup options
rollupOptions: {
// Use the dynamically created input object to tell Vite which files to build
input: inputFiles,
},
},
// Configure the dev server
server: {
// Disable history API fallback for a multi-page application
historyApiFallback: false,
},
});
